Narrow Linewidth Fiber Grating F-P Cavity Laser and Application

Narrow line-width fiber grating 1535 nm Erbium laser was demonstrated by introducing fiber grating F-P cavity. It was composed by high Er3+ doped fiber, 980/1550nm WDM and fiber grating F-P cavity. Linear and ring cavity experiments were demonstrated respectively. In the experiment, pumped by 976nm diode laser, the associated fiber lasers with frequency selecting by fiber grating F-P cavity exhibited about 11mW threshold. 15% and 30% slope efficiency were obtained respectively in the experiments. The 3dB line-width of fiber lasers were both less than 0.01nm, and SNR were both about 50dB. Narrow linewidth fiber laser can be used to build distributed fiber optical sensor systems. Frequency modulated continuous wave (FMCW) technique and Brillouin optical fiber time domain reflectometry (BOTDR) technique were described in this paper.
